Maintenance Guidelines
Regular upkeep of your luxury timepiece ensures optimal performance and longevity. Here are key practices to consider:
Routine Winding: For mechanical watches, winding is necessary if not worn frequently. Aim for manual winding once a week to maintain power reserve. If your model features an automatic movement, wearing it daily keeps the mechanism fully operational.
Water Resistance Check: Conduct a waterproof test annually to confirm seals are intact. Exposing the watch to moisture can lead to internal damage. Always rinse the watch with freshwater after swimming in saltwater or chlorinated pools, and dry it immediately with a soft cloth.
Cleaning: Clean the case and bracelet regularly using a soft brush and mild soap solution. Avoid harsh chemicals. For leather straps, use a leather conditioner to preserve their quality. A microfiber cloth is ideal for polishing the crystal without scratching it.
Battery Replacement: If your timepiece is quartz, replace the battery every two to three years. Seek professional service to ensure it's sealed properly afterward, maintaining its water resistance.
Professional Servicing: Schedule a full service every five years. During this process, experts will disassemble, clean, lubricate, and reassemble the movement. This procedure helps in identifying potential issues early and significantly lengthens the watch's lifespan.
Storage: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Consider using a watch winder for automatic models to keep lubricants evenly distributed. Avoid placing on surfaces where vibrations are frequent, which could affect the internal mechanics.
Following these guidelines will aid in retaining the precision and elegance of your cherished watch for generations.
